MANSELL, THE. AKA - "Mansel, The." English, Country Dance Tune (cut time). G Major. Standard tuning (fiddle). AB. The melody was first published by Henry Playford in his Dancing Master, 11th edition (1701, p. 308), and was retained in the long-running Dancing Master series through the 18th and final edition of 1728 (then published by John Young, heir to the Playford publishing conerns). It was also published by John Walsh in his Compleat Country Dancing Master, editions of 1719, 1731 and 1754. It was included in the 1694 music manuscript collection of Northumbrian musician Henry Atkinson (Morpeth) under the generically-titled "Scotch Tune (1) (A)." Nearly a century later it was entered into the 1790 music copybook collection of London musician Thomas Hammersley as "Mansill, or My Loveing Cuzen."
